About the Mission Hill Fenway Buccaneers
Building Champions On and Off the Field
The Mission Hill Fenway Buccaneers Youth Football & Cheerleading program is more than just a sports organization—we are a community-driven family dedicated to transforming the lives of young people through the power of athletics, mentorship, and unwavering support. Serving children ages 5-15 from Mission Hill, Roxbury, Jamaica Plain, South End, Fenway, and surrounding neighborhoods, we believe that every child deserves the opportunity to reach their full potential.
Our Mission
In partnership with Boston Partners in Mentoring, our goal is to develop and implement mentoring programs that will nurture the social, educational, physical, emotional, and economic growth of the student-athlete. We recognize that the struggle to support our at-risk youth is becoming increasingly difficult and complex. The powerfully negative messages and role models that inner-city youth often encounter in their homes, streets, or through media require high-impact alternatives that can truly make a difference.

What We Do
Our comprehensive program combines competitive youth football and cheerleading with essential life skills development. We understand that athletic achievement is just one piece of the puzzle. Through structured practices, games, and mentoring sessions, we teach our young athletes:
- Discipline and Time Management - Learning to balance academics, athletics, and personal responsibilities
- Leadership Skills - Developing the confidence to lead by example both on and off the field
- Teamwork and Communication - Understanding how to work effectively with others toward common goals
- Resilience and Perseverance - Building the mental strength to overcome challenges and setbacks
- Self-Respect and Positive Self-Esteem - Fostering a healthy sense of self-worth and personal pride
- Sportsmanship and Character - Emphasizing fair play, respect for opponents, and ethical behavior
